  • Stop Mixing Money: Cash Flow Systems for Freedom | Mando Sallavanti | Growing Money with Sean Trace
    2025/09/16

    In this episode I sit down with CFP Mando Sallavanti III to talk practical money rules for entrepreneurs and high earners. Mando explains why separating business and personal finances matters, why most founders need a bookkeeper and CPA, and how to keep 1 to 3 months of operating expenses in your business account. We dig into hiring for leverage, the accumulation versus distribution mindset, and Mando’s bucket and reservoir systems that make saving automatic while giving you permission to spend. If you want clear cash flow habits, a plan to protect your income, and real steps to turn wealth into freedom, this one is for you.

  • Money Scripts: The Hidden Stories Controlling You Wallet | Money School with Prof. Stephen Heath
    2025/06/28

    In this episode of Growing Money with Sean Trace, I sit down with my friend Stephen Heath to talk about something a little different, but incredibly important—the psychology behind how we think about money. We explore a concept called “money scripts,” which are the unconscious beliefs we form early in life that shape our financial decisions as adults.

    We share some pretty funny and personal stories, from finding a Rolex at the bottom of a pool to the heartbreak of giving back a money clip full of cash. Stephen opens up about his family’s legacy of wealth and how one decision led to generations of financial difference. I talk about my own upbringing, the influence of conservative views on money, and how those beliefs still show up in my life today.

    We break down the four core money scripts: money avoidance, money worship, money status, and money vigilance. And as we talked, we realized something was missing, so we introduced a fifth one—money balance. Because the truth is, most of us carry a mix of all these scripts, and the goal should not be perfection, but awareness and balance.
